Poll: Renua or the Social Democrats?

Is this town big enough for both of them?

THE IRISH POLITICAL landscape has got quite the revamp in recent months with two new, fully-fledged parties now in town.

This week, we noted some interesting reader polls (which are totally unscientific, but as we said, still interesting).

In March, we asked you if you would vote for Renua in the next election. You said no, resoundingly. Only 12% of those taking said they would vote for Renua.

This week, you were more positive about Roisin Shortall, Catherine Murphy and Stephen Donnelly - with 55% saying that they would vote for them.

Today, we’re putting them head-to-head. Who are you more likely to vote for come general election, Renua or the SocDems?


Poll Results:

Social Democrats (7585)
Neither (3498)
Renua (1110)
I won't vote (179)
